Blind Brook High School Principal To Step Down

RYE BROOK, N.Y. -- Blind Brook High School Principal Gina Healy will step down at the end of the school year.

Healy will be taking on the position of assistant superintendent for human resources at Bedford Central School District next year. She has served as principal of Blind Brook High School for the past three years.

The Board of Education accepted Healy's resignation at its Monday meeting. Blind Brook Middle School Principal Patricia Lambert was appointed the new principal of the high school. Lambert has been principal of the middle school for the past two years. Prior to that, she was a middle school principal in Mendham, New Jersey from 2005 to 2011, and worked in Somerville High School from 1992 to 2005.

Todd Richard, the associate principal for the middle school and high school, was selected to take over as interim principal for Blind Brook Middle School next year. He has served as associate principal for the past two years.

Healy's resignation will take effect June 30. A search will be conducted to find a permanent principal for Blind Brook Middle School, and an interim associate principal will be hired to assume Richard's duties next year.
